This might be an incredibly stupid question but I'm going to ask it anyway. I have a 2004 Celica GTS with the TRD Front BBK which is apparently the stoptech st-40. Can they be retrofitted onto the NSX? I don't track the Celica it just came with them when I bought it used. Technically yes, these can be retrofitted onto an NSX. Stoptech already makes a BBK for the NSX so you would either need to get those caliper brackets or fabricate them yourself. HOWEVER, it is not recommend to just retrofit any caliper laying around. You have to take into account proper brake bias. Stoptech uses custom piston sizes to insure the proper brake bias for each specific vehicle.
